Details for Ton-Hour (Refrigeration)
Introduction : One ton-hour is the energy needed to provide one ton of refrigeration for one hour. It equals 12,000 Btu (IT), or approximately 12.66 MJ.
History & Origin : Evolved from early air conditioning ratings where one 'ton' meant the energy to melt one ton of ice over 24 hours. Standardized in HVAC engineering.
Current Use : Used to size and rate cooling systems, especially chillers and commercial air conditioners. Vital in HVAC, building design, and energy audits.
Details for Tera-Electron-Volt
Introduction : A tera-electron-volt equals one trillion electron-volts. This is a unit reserved for the highest energy processes in particle physics and cosmology.
History & Origin : Introduced to represent the energy scales explored in 21st-century particle accelerators. TeV became prominent with the LHC's high-energy experiments.
Current Use : Used to describe extremely high energies in particle collisions, such as those used to identify the Higgs boson or simulate early-universe conditions.
